Cyber-attacks are steadily on the rise, so it is critical for an MSP security team to continually look for new ways to protect companies from the wide variety of cyber threats. As you know, cybercriminals will target businesses of all sizes and it is important to provide superb service for each client, whether they are a small business or large company. Fortunately, the use of a managed detection and response security method can help you prevent the vast majority of attacks. For example, instead of solely focusing on the prevention of cyber-attacks, you can have a tighter security detail. Managed detection and response is a 24-hour service that is continually looking for any signs of cyber breaches. If any vulnerability is found, you will isolate and remove the issue before it turns into a significant problem. Frequent Security Updates
Another added benefit of utilizing managed detection and response is the ability to provide the ultimate MSP security protection through the use of frequent security updates. This security method will show your IT staff of any weaknesses within your client’s system and will give them an excellent idea on how to make any necessary adjustments or changes to enhance security. For example, if they notice that the virus protection isn’t correctly scanning each email, it may be time to install a newer version that offers the latest protection. Ultimately, providing frequent security updates will ensure each client is protected and is another added layer of security in today’s business environment.
Provide Cloud Technology
As you know, sometimes a cyber-attack can severely damage the hard drive of a client’s computer. Fortunately, providing cloud technology will enable your client to restore data from a previous save point. These data backups can be set at any time, whether it is on a daily, weekly, or monthly basis. The use of a data backup and recovery is just another added layer of protection for clients against mass data loss. The use of cloud services will also make the jobs of each client’s employee’s easier, as multiple employees can work on the same project, simultaneously. Employees can also work from any location, whether it is at home or on a business trip.
